using Ryujinx.Audio.Common;
using Ryujinx.Audio.Integration;
using Ryujinx.Memory;
using System;
using System.Threading;
using static Ryujinx.Audio.Integration.IHardwareDeviceDriver;
namespace Ryujinx.Audio.Backends.Dummy
{
public class DummyHardwareDeviceDriver : IHardwareDeviceDriver
{
private readonly ManualResetEvent _updateRequiredEvent;
private readonly ManualResetEvent _pauseEvent;
public static bool IsSupported => true;
public DummyHardwareDeviceDriver()
{
_updateRequiredEvent = new ManualResetEvent(false);
_pauseEvent = new ManualResetEvent(true);
}
public IHardwareDeviceSession OpenDeviceSession(Direction direction, IVirtualMemoryManager memoryManager, SampleFormat sampleFormat, uint sampleRate, uint channelCount, float volume)
{
if (sampleRate == 0)
{
sampleRate = Constants.TargetSampleRate;
}
if (channelCount == 0)
{
channelCount = 2;
}
if (direction == Direction.Output)
{
return new DummyHardwareDeviceSessionOutput(this, memoryManager, sampleFormat, sampleRate, channelCount, volume);
}
return new DummyHardwareDeviceSessionInput(this, memoryManager);
}
public ManualResetEvent GetUpdateRequiredEvent()
{
return _updateRequiredEvent;
}
public ManualResetEvent GetPauseEvent()
{
return _pauseEvent;
}
public void Dispose()
{
GC.SuppressFinalize(this);
Dispose(true);
}
protected virtual void Dispose(bool disposing)
{
if (disposing)
{
// NOTE: The _updateRequiredEvent will be disposed somewhere else.
_pauseEvent.Dispose();
}
}
public bool SupportsSampleRate(uint sampleRate)
{
return true;
}
public bool SupportsSampleFormat(SampleFormat sampleFormat)
{
return true;
}
public bool SupportsDirection(Direction direction)
{
return direction == Direction.Output || direction == Direction.Input;
}
public bool SupportsChannelCount(uint channelCount)
{
return channelCount == 1 || channelCount == 2 || channelCount == 6;
}
}
}
